Hela's Bane: A Novella (Dragon-Myth Prequel Book 1) Kindle Edition
A.D. 775—In the village of Ellryk, a sinister secret lurks, threatening the lives of three young women. Maugis d’Aygremont, a knight of Charlemagne and a master of the arcane arts, is determined to save them.
As Hexennacht—Witches’ Night—approaches, fear grips the village. Each year, Hela descends from the mountain, instilling terror in the hearts of the villagers. Legend says she is Loki’s daughter, the goddess of the dead, a being half human and half corpse-like, riding in on a wave of fog.
But is there more to her origin than the ancient tales suggest?
Maugis must uncover the truth behind Hela’s existence, for the fate of the women—and perhaps the entire village—depends on it.

About the author

Joseph Finley is a writer of historical fantasy fiction. Following a tour as an officer in the U.S. Navy Judge Advocate General’s Corps, he returned to Atlanta where he lives with his wife, daughter, and two mischievous rescue dogs. A lifelong love of medieval history, vintage fantasy, and historical mysteries helped inspire his writing, along with a penchant for European travel. Joseph is a member of the Science Fiction and Fantasy Writers of America, and posts frequently about historical and fantasy fiction on his blog. He can be found most nights enjoying a hearty glass of wine, and in the wee hours of most mornings surrounded by history books and plugging away on his next story.
